Do redheads overheat faster?

Yes, redheads are generally more sensitive to thermal pain (both heat and cold) due to variations in the MC1R gene, which affects pain perception pathways, making them feel temperature extremes more intensely and requiring different responses to pain medication and anesthesia. While they often need more anesthesia for procedures, studies show they have lower tolerance for heat/cold pain but can be less sensitive to certain skin pain like electric shock.

Are redheads more sensitive to the heat?

This same gene may also play a role in how redheads perceive different types of pain. For example, patients with red hair have been found to be: Less sensitive to electric shock, stinging, and needle-prick pain on the skin, but… More sensitive to thermal pain, such as heat and cold.

Do gingers struggle to regulate temperature?

Researchers think that the ginger gene, known as MC1R, may cause the temperature-detecting gene to become over-activated, making redheads more sensitive to the cold. It is hoped that this research can be used to develop better pain-relieving drugs and anaesthetics.

Are redheads prone to obesity?

Moreover, in 1998, Krude et al. demonstrated that early-onset obesity was correlated with red hair color in two patients with POMC mutations (Krude et al. 1998). The patients had a mutation which either interferes with the synthesis of α-MSH or abolishes POMC translation.

What illnesses are redheads prone to?

About 1–2% of people of European origin have red hair. Especially female redheads are known to suffer higher pain sensitivity and higher incidence of some disorders, including skin cancer, Parkinson's disease and endometriosis.

Why can't ginger people go in the sun?

However, people with red hair, fair skin, and freckles do not tan due to a mutation in the MC1R receptor gene. This stops melanin from working properly. Cells only produce pheomelanin, which doesn't protect against sunburns and DNA damage from the sun's harmful rays.

Do redheads have higher vitamin D?

More efficient vitamin D synthesis

One small study found that redheads had higher levels of a vitamin D precursor in their blood and suggested that this may be an evolutionary adaptation allowing for sufficient synthesis of provitamin D under lower intensity light conditions such as found in Northern Europe [18].

Do redheads age more quickly?

Redheads may age faster

A study in Current Biology found that people who had two copies of the MC1R gene (which confers red hair), appeared as many as two years older than people who did not hold both copies. According to the authors, this was about the same as the effect of smoking on perceived age.

Are redheads more prone to heart problems?

We found elevated CRP levels in red-haired women in the NHS. This finding could potentially explain a prior report of increased risks of cardiovascular disease and cancer in red-haired women (Frost et al.
